LLM is an acronym denoting Master of Laws, also recognized by its distinguished Latin counterpart, Legum Magister. It represents a postgraduate pursuit undertaken by erudite scholars subsequent to the acquisition of a bachelor’s degree from an esteemed institution of higher learning. Eligibility Criteria for LLM Programme
If you are the one looking for an LLM programme as a part of your higher study, you must be aware of the eligibility requirements. Let’s have a quick look at the basic eligibility criteria for LLM programme.- Educational requirement: The applicant must have earned a bachelor degree in law from an accredited institution. Candidates may apply for an LLM program while awaiting their final year/semester graduation results. Candidates must, however, have earned their LLB degree prior to the admission date.
- Minimum qualifying marks: Each college has its own requirements for minimum marks.
